Description

Domaine Daniel Bouland Morgon Corcelette is the concrete-raised, earliest-drinking wine in the domaine's set of Corcelette bottlings.

Corcelette lies on the Chiroubles side of Morgon, where sandy granitic soils produce more perfume and finer, rounder tannins than the schist-influenced terroirs closer to the Côte du Py. Daniel Bouland keeps his younger vines here separate from the oldest bush vines, which are bottled as Vieilles Vignes, though younger is relative: these average around 60 years. As with every wine at the domaine, fermentation is whole-bunch with indigenous yeasts, and the must is foot-trodden at the end to prolong the ferment. Where the old-vine cuvées are raised in wooden foudre, this one stays in concrete tank, which keeps the fruit forward and the frame lighter. It is the prettiest and most immediately accessible of the range.

Unusually ready for a young Bouland Morgon, and good for four to six years. Serve at 16°C with charcuterie, roast chicken or a mushroom tart.
